    For more than 40 years, Fearey has been one of the West Coast’s largest independent Public Relations agency, serving a wide variety of clients ranging from healthcare to professional services to construction/real estate and consumer-facing businesses. Their mission is simple and one which they live by every day: To build trusting and enduring relationships - one conversation at a time. They also embrace Fearless Thinking by collaborating in ways to push them to think of new and effective ideas to amplify a client's brand message to its key audience. They are a full-service communications agency, providing public relations, social media, marketing and design, public affairs and crisis management support. They were a founding member of the Public Relations Global Network. In 2021, they were named one of America's best PR firms by Forbes.
